| | 3-Aminophenylboronic acid monohydrate Usage And Synthesis |
| Chemical Properties | beige to brown crystalline powder or crystals | | Uses | 3-Aminophenylboronic acid monohydrate can be used in suzuki reaction.
| | Uses | 3-Aminophenylboronic acid monohydrate is a amino substituted aryl boronic acid used as a base for developing amphiphilic, random glycopolymers, which self-assemble to form nanoparticles (NPs) with potential as a glucose-sensitive agent. 3-Aminophenylboronic Acid is also used as a reagent in the preparation of nonbenzodiazepine hypnotic agents.
| | Uses | It is employed as a reagent in the preparation of Suzuki-Miyaura cross-coupling, used for Gram-positive ant virulence drugs and inhibitors of Streptococcus agalactiae Stk1, regioisomer of Zaleplon (a sedative), amphiphilic random glycopolymer, which self-assemble to form nanoparticles, with potential as a glucose-sensitive matrix, chemomechanical polymer that expands and contracts in blood plasma with high glucose selectivity. Aminophenylboronic Acid is also used as a reagent in the preparation of nonbenzodiazepine hypnotic agents. |
